If you’ve been in a situation where you’ve locked your keys inside the car, you might be wondering how much should it cost for a locksmith to unlock it. There are a few factors that will determine the exact amount of money that you will have to pay, including the time of day, the make and model of your car, and the type of locksmith that you decide to hire.
The first thing that you should do is to call around and get quotes from local locksmiths. This will help you to compare prices, and will also give you a good idea of what to expect when the locksmith arrives at your location.
Next, you need to be sure that the locksmith is reputable and has professional training. This means that they’re licensed and insured, and should have a clean background check with the state. This will also ensure that they’re legally permitted to work in your area and that they have the proper tools for the job.
You should always check the credentials of any locksmith before hiring them, and it’s worth doing this online too, by looking at reviews and customer service platforms. The best way to do this is to look for a company with a consistent brand, logo, and website.
This will show that they’re a legitimate business and that they have a strong reputation in their community. Moreover, it will ensure that they have a lot of experience in the field.
Another thing to check for is the quality of their service and the speed at which they can respond to your call. This is especially important if you’re dealing with an emergency.
A trustworthy locksmith will offer a fixed price, and won’t surprise you with hidden fees or markups. This is a common practice with many companies, so be sure to check this before you hire them.
The cost of a locksmith to unlock your newer car should never be more than a few hundred dollars. This is because it depends on the complexity of the situation and the services that the locksmith has to provide.
